common-close-0
BYDFi
獲取應用程序並隨時隨地進行交易!

如何使用Python編寫一個與數字貨幣交易所Binance相關的自動化交易程序?

avatarIntizar AfghanMar 19, 2022 · 3 years ago7 answers

我想使用Python編寫一個與數字貨幣交易所Binance相關的自動化交易程序,可以請您提供詳細的步驟和指導嗎?

如何使用Python編寫一個與數字貨幣交易所Binance相關的自動化交易程序?

7 answers

  • avatarMar 19, 2022 · 3 years ago
    當涉及到與數字貨幣交易所Binance相關的自動化交易程序時,使用Python是一種常見且強大的選擇。下面是一些詳細的步驟和指導,幫助您開始編寫自己的程序。首先,您需要在Binance上創建一個賬戶並獲取API密鑰。然後,您可以使用Python的Binance API庫來與Binance交互。這個庫提供了各種功能,包括獲取市場數據、執行交易和管理訂單等。您可以使用pip安裝這個庫,並閱讀官方文檔以瞭解如何使用它。接下來,您需要編寫代碼來連接到Binance API,並執行您所需的操作。您可以使用Python的requests庫發送HTTP請求,並使用API密鑰進行身份驗證。例如,您可以使用GET請求獲取市場數據,或使用POST請求執行交易。您還可以使用Python的json庫來解析和處理API返回的數據。在編寫代碼時,您可以根據您的需求選擇適當的策略和算法。例如,您可以編寫代碼來執行市場製造商策略、套利策略或技術指標策略。最後,您需要確保您的代碼穩定可靠,並進行充分的測試和調試。您可以使用Python的單元測試框架來測試您的代碼,並使用日誌記錄來跟蹤和調試錯誤。總之,使用Python編寫與數字貨幣交易所Binance相關的自動化交易程序是可行的,只要您遵循上述步驟和指導,您就可以開始構建您自己的程序了。祝您成功!
  • avatarMar 19, 2022 · 3 years ago
    在編寫與數字貨幣交易所Binance相關的自動化交易程序時,Python是一種廣泛使用的編程語言。下面是一些詳細的步驟和指導,幫助您開始編寫自己的程序。首先,您需要安裝Python並設置您的開發環境。然後,您可以使用Python的Binance API庫來與Binance交互。這個庫提供了各種功能,包括獲取市場數據、執行交易和管理訂單等。您可以使用pip安裝這個庫,並閱讀官方文檔以瞭解如何使用它。接下來,您需要編寫代碼來連接到Binance API,並執行您所需的操作。您可以使用Python的requests庫發送HTTP請求,並使用API密鑰進行身份驗證。例如,您可以使用GET請求獲取市場數據,或使用POST請求執行交易。在編寫代碼時,您可以根據您的需求選擇適當的策略和算法。例如,您可以編寫代碼來執行市場製造商策略、套利策略或技術指標策略。最後,您需要測試和優化您的代碼。您可以使用Python的單元測試框架來測試您的代碼,並使用性能分析工具來優化代碼的執行效率。總之,使用Python編寫與數字貨幣交易所Binance相關的自動化交易程序是可行的,只要您遵循上述步驟和指導,您就可以開始構建您自己的程序了。
  • avatarMar 19, 2022 · 3 years ago
    在編寫與數字貨幣交易所Binance相關的自動化交易程序時,Python是一種非常強大的編程語言。使用Python編寫自動化交易程序的好處之一是它的易用性和靈活性。您可以使用Python的Binance API庫來與Binance交互,並執行各種操作,如獲取市場數據、執行交易和管理訂單等。首先,您需要在Binance上創建一個賬戶並獲取API密鑰。然後,您可以使用Python的Binance API庫來連接到Binance API,並使用API密鑰進行身份驗證。接下來,您可以編寫代碼來執行您所需的操作。例如,您可以使用GET請求獲取市場數據,或使用POST請求執行交易。在編寫代碼時,您可以根據您的需求選擇適當的策略和算法。例如,您可以編寫代碼來執行市場製造商策略、套利策略或技術指標策略。最後,您需要測試和優化您的代碼,確保它穩定可靠。您可以使用Python的單元測試框架來測試您的代碼,並使用性能分析工具來優化代碼的執行效率。總之,使用Python編寫與數字貨幣交易所Binance相關的自動化交易程序是可行的,只要您掌握了必要的知識和技能,您就可以開始構建您自己的程序了。
  • avatarMar 19, 2022 · 3 years ago
    當涉及到與數字貨幣交易所Binance相關的自動化交易程序時,Python是一個非常受歡迎的編程語言。使用Python編寫自動化交易程序的好處之一是它的廣泛的庫和工具生態系統。您可以使用Python的Binance API庫來與Binance交互,並執行各種操作,如獲取市場數據、執行交易和管理訂單等。首先,您需要在Binance上創建一個賬戶並獲取API密鑰。然後,您可以使用Python的Binance API庫來連接到Binance API,並使用API密鑰進行身份驗證。接下來,您可以編寫代碼來執行您所需的操作。例如,您可以使用GET請求獲取市場數據,或使用POST請求執行交易。在編寫代碼時,您可以根據您的需求選擇適當的策略和算法。例如,您可以編寫代碼來執行市場製造商策略、套利策略或技術指標策略。最後,您需要測試和優化您的代碼,確保它穩定可靠。您可以使用Python的單元測試框架來測試您的代碼,並使用性能分析工具來優化代碼的執行效率。總之,使用Python編寫與數字貨幣交易所Binance相關的自動化交易程序是可行的,只要您掌握了必要的知識和技能,您就可以開始構建您自己的程序了。
  • avatarMar 19, 2022 · 3 years ago
    在編寫與數字貨幣交易所Binance相關的自動化交易程序時,Python是一種流行的編程語言。使用Python編寫自動化交易程序的好處之一是它的簡潔性和易用性。您可以使用Python的Binance API庫來與Binance交互,並執行各種操作,如獲取市場數據、執行交易和管理訂單等。首先,您需要在Binance上創建一個賬戶並獲取API密鑰。然後,您可以使用Python的Binance API庫來連接到Binance API,並使用API密鑰進行身份驗證。接下來,您可以編寫代碼來執行您所需的操作。例如,您可以使用GET請求獲取市場數據,或使用POST請求執行交易。在編寫代碼時,您可以根據您的需求選擇適當的策略和算法。例如,您可以編寫代碼來執行市場製造商策略、套利策略或技術指標策略。最後,您需要測試和優化您的代碼,確保它穩定可靠。您可以使用Python的單元測試框架來測試您的代碼,並使用性能分析工具來優化代碼的執行效率。總之,使用Python編寫與數字貨幣交易所Binance相關的自動化交易程序是可行的,只要您掌握了必要的知識和技能,您就可以開始構建您自己的程序了。
  • avatarMar 19, 2022 · 3 years ago
    在編寫與數字貨幣交易所Binance相關的自動化交易程序時,Python是一種非常流行和強大的編程語言。使用Python編寫自動化交易程序的好處之一是它的易用性和靈活性。您可以使用Python的Binance API庫來與Binance交互,並執行各種操作,如獲取市場數據、執行交易和管理訂單等。首先,您需要在Binance上創建一個賬戶並獲取API密鑰。然後,您可以使用Python的Binance API庫來連接到Binance API,並使用API密鑰進行身份驗證。接下來,您可以編寫代碼來執行您所需的操作。例如,您可以使用GET請求獲取市場數據,或使用POST請求執行交易。在編寫代碼時,您可以根據您的需求選擇適當的策略和算法。例如,您可以編寫代碼來執行市場製造商策略、套利策略或技術指標策略。最後,您需要測試和優化您的代碼,確保它穩定可靠。您可以使用Python的單元測試框架來測試您的代碼,並使用性能分析工具來優化代碼的執行效率。總之,使用Python編寫與數字貨幣交易所Binance相關的自動化交易程序是可行的,只要您掌握了必要的知識和技能,您就可以開始構建您自己的程序了。
  • avatarMar 19, 2022 · 3 years ago
    在編寫與數字貨幣交易所Binance相關的自動化交易程序時,使用Python是一種非常常見和方便的選擇。Python擁有豐富的庫和工具生態系統,可以幫助您更輕鬆地編寫程序。首先,您需要在Binance上創建一個賬戶並獲取API密鑰。然後,您可以使用Python的Binance API庫來與Binance交互。這個庫提供了各種功能,包括獲取市場數據、執行交易和管理訂單等。您可以使用pip安裝這個庫,並閱讀官方文檔以瞭解如何使用它。接下來,您需要編寫代碼來連接到Binance API,並執行您所需的操作。您可以使用Python的requests庫發送HTTP請求,並使用API密鑰進行身份驗證。例如,您可以使用GET請求獲取市場數據,或使用POST請求執行交易。在編寫代碼時,您可以根據您的需求選擇適當的策略和算法。例如,您可以編寫代碼來執行市場製造商策略、套利策略或技術指標策略。最後,您需要確保您的代碼穩定可靠,並進行充分的測試和調試。您可以使用Python的單元測試框架來測試您的代碼,並使用日誌記錄來跟蹤和調試錯誤。總之,使用Python編寫與數字貨幣交易所Binance相關的自動化交易程序是可行的,只要您遵循上述步驟和指導,您就可以開始構建您自己的程序了。祝您成功!